What is G W Thiel?
Established in 1977, G W Thiel operates as a premier provider of custom carpentry, rough framing, and high-end millwork services. The firm distinguishes itself through a union-backed workforce that serves both residential and commercial markets. By prioritizing craftsmanship and long-term client trust, the company has evolved from a family-owned enterprise into a sophisticated construction entity capable of executing complex, large-scale projects. Their market position is defined by a commitment to precision, ensuring that architectural visions are realized within strict budgetary and temporal constraints.
